Mechanical deadlocks

Mechanical deadlocks for vans are a preferred option to increase the security of the vehicle. The lock mechanism works by putting a bolt into the receiver to a body section on the other side of the van. This bolt is operated with an external key, which provides an additional layer of security.

Sometimes, a deadlock can be more effective than a standard lock with a slam. These locks can be used to protect heavy parcels. They can also be installed on the sides of a vehicle to keep thieves from gaining access to the interior.

Hook locks

Hook locks are great to increase the security of your vehicle. They offer a level of security that deadlocks can't provide. They are often installed in strategic places around the van . They also provide an effective visual deterrent. Hook locks can make it impossible to use the crowbar. It is a tool commonly employed by criminals to gain access to vehicles.

Hook locks are a type mechanical deadlock, which is put on the doors of commercial vehicles. These locks are extremely reliable and can add additional security to your vehicle. They attach the hook bolt to an adjustable bracket. To unlock the hook bolt an external key with high-security is employed.
